Got back in touch with SM about this custom jacket that measured short (about 3/4 in from spec). They gave me the following options:

1. Have their tailors lengthen the jacket as close to the spec as possible
2. Get store credit for 10% of the price of the jacket (they rounded up to $70)

What's the take here? They assured me they have the ability to lengthen jackets a tad but I know this isn't a normal alteration and you have to be careful on the fronts especially.

3/4" short is not a small error. I think you'd be well within your rights to ask for a remake. I know that I would not be happy with a jacket that was this off. I would not be at all satisfied with $70.

You could give them a chance to alter the jacket but they need to agree that if you are not satisfied with the result then they will remake.
